Measuring Economic Impacts: The Application of Input-Output Analysis to California Water Resources Problems

The study describes the development and application of a California statewide and twelve intrastate regional input-output (I-O) models. The statewide model, developed for 1976, consists of 156 sectors with emphasis on high water users, including 36 agricultural categories. The model is resource-oriented, providing estimate of direct and secondary employment, and of energy and water resource use for every million dollars of final demand sales. These resource uses vary by industry, depending on the industry, the resource considered, and the intensity of resource use by related industries. Details of the models and their application, including microfiches of the complete statewide transactions, technical coefficients, and inverse tables, are presented for those interested in the technical aspects of the models or in making further applications.
